The regulation applies to all private sector companies and public sector clients that fulfill... WebSep 26, 2024 · IR35 is a piece of UK tax legislation. It’s designed to close a loophole in the tax system where workers could use the setup of a limited company structure in order to pay less tax. Where, despite a contract being with a limited company, the reality is more like an employer-employee relationship, the worker should be taxed as an employee.

WebWhere the worker is inside IR35, the business, agency, or third party paying the worker’s company will need to deduct income tax, employee National Insurance (NI) and pay employer NI.
